Flight Controller F405-WING (new) STM32F405, MPU6000, INAVOSD, BMP280, 6x UARTs, 1x Softserial, 2x I2C, 2x Motors & 7x Servos, 4x BEC &
current sensor on board.
Specs & Features
FC Specifications
• MCU: 168MHz STM32F405
• IMU: MPU6000 accelerometer/gyro (SPI)
• Baro: BMP280 (I2C)
• OSD: INAV OSD w/ AT7456E chip
• Blackbox: MicroSD card slot (SD/SDHC)
• VCP & 6x UARTs
• 2x Motors, 7x Servos outputs
• 2x I2C
• 3x LEDs for FC STATUS (Blue, Red) and 3.3V indicator(Red)
• Built in inverter for SBUS input (UART2-RX)
• PPM/UART Shared: UART2-RX
• SoftSerial on TX2 pad
• Battery Voltage Sensor: 1:10 (Scale 1100)
• WS2812 Led Strip : Yes
• Beeper : Yes
• RSSI: Yes
FC Firmware
• INAV Flight
• Target: MATEKF405SE
PDB
• Input voltage range: 9~30V (3~6S LiPo) w/TVS protection
• 2x ESC power pads
• Current Senor: 104A, 3.3V ADC, Scale 317
BEC 5V output
• Designed for Flight controller, Receiver, OSD, Camera, Buzzer, 2812 LED_Strip, Buzzer, GPS module,
AirSpeed
• Continuous current: 2 Amps, Max.3A
BEC 9V /12V output
• Designed for Video Transmitter, Camera, Gimbal ect.
• Continuous current: 2 Amps, Max.3A
• 12V option with Jumper pad
BEC Vx output
• Designed for Servos
• Voltage adjustable, 5V Default, 6V or 7.2V via jumper
• Continuous current: 5 Amps, Max.6A
• Output Ripple: 50mV (VIn=24V, VOut=5V@5A load)
BEC 3.3V output
• Designed for Baro / Compass module and Spektrum RX
• Linear Regulator
• Continuous current: 500mA
Physical
• Mounting: 30.5 x 30.5mm, Φ4mm with Grommets Φ3mm
• Dimensions: 56 x 36 x 13 mm
• Weight: 25g
CLI command for Motors of Custom Mixer
• mmix 0 1.0 0.0 0.0 0.0 # motor1
• mmix 1 1.0 0.0 0.0 0.0 # motor2
• save
